Corrected Question :-
- A bus starts from rest and attains speed of 36 km/hr in 10 minutes while moving with uniform acceleration. What will be the acceleration of bus ?
a.) 0.21 m/s²
b.) 0.016 m/s²
c.) 0.45 m/s²
d.) 0.123 m/s²
Answer :
- Acceleration of the bus is 0.016 m/s².
- Option b.) 0.016 m/s² is correct ✓
Given :-
- A bus starts from rest and attains speed of 36 km/hr in 10 minutes while moving with uniform acceleration.
To Find :-
- What will be the acceleration of bus ?
Solution :-
- Let the acceleration of bus be x.
As per the provided information in the given question,
We have,
- Initial velocity of the bus (u) = 0 m/s
Here,
- Initial velocity (u) is taken 0 because the bus has started from rest.
- This means his velocity is initially 0.
- Final velocity of the bus (v) = 36 km/h
- Time taken (t) = 10 minutes
We are asked to calculate the acceleration of the bus.
- We'll be calculating acceleration in its SI unit. So, we need to convert the given units as per the M.K.S system.
Here,
- v = 36 km/h
We need to convert it into m/s. In order to convert km/h to m/s, we multiply the value with 5/18.
➻ v = (36 × 5/18)m/s
➻ v = (2 × 5)m/s
➻ v = 10 m/s
Also,
➻ Time = 10 minutes
- 1 minute = 60 seconds
➻ Time = (10 × 60)s
➻ Time = 600 s
Now, we have,
- Initial velocity (u) = 0 m/s
- Final velocity (v) = 10 m/s
- Time (t) = 600 s
Now,
- Let's find out the acceleration.
By using the first equation of motion,
We know that,
• Using formula,
- v = u + at
We have,
- v denotes final velocity
- u denotes initial velocity
- a denotes acceleration
- t denotes time
• Putting all values in formula,
➻ 10 = 0 + 600a
➻ 10 - 0 = 600a
➻ 10 = 600a
➻ 10/600 = a
➻ 1/60 = a
➻ a = 0.016 m/s²
- Hence, acceleration of the bus is 0.016 m/s².
